Why Do People Marry? A Multitude of Reasons
It's fascinating to consider the many reasons why individuals choose to marry. The provided text tells us that people may marry for a truly wide array of purposes, and it's not always just one single thing. For some, the legal benefits are paramount; marriage, after all, establishes certain rights and obligations that can be quite significant in areas like inheritance or healthcare. Others might prioritize the social acceptance that comes with being married, finding comfort in conforming to cultural norms. It’s a very practical decision for some, too, offering financial stability or economic advantages that might be harder to achieve alone.
Beyond the more tangible reasons, there are also deeply personal and emotional drivers. Many marry for profound emotional connections, seeking companionship, mutual support, and a partner to share life's joys and sorrows. The romantic ideal of finding "the one" and committing to them forever is, still, a powerful motivator for countless couples. There's also a strong spiritual or religious component for many, where marriage is seen as a sacred bond, blessed by a higher power. These reasons, quite frankly, often intertwine, creating a rich tapestry of motivations for entering into matrimony.
Then, you have the cultural and political dimensions. In some societies, marriage plays a crucial role in maintaining social structures or forging alliances between families. Historically, it was, in fact, often a political tool. Even today, cultural traditions often dictate how and why people marry, influencing everything from ceremony customs to expectations of married life. And, of course, the sexual aspect is a fundamental, natural part of many marital unions, providing intimacy and connection within a committed framework. What are the legal implications of being married for individuals?
Being married carries several significant legal implications for individuals. As the text explains, marriage is a legally recognized union that establishes specific rights and obligations between spouses. This includes things like shared property rights, inheritance rights, healthcare decision-making, and even tax benefits. It’s a legal framework that, in a way, provides a structure for the couple's shared life and future. These legal aspects are, basically, a core part of what defines the married state in many jurisdictions around the world.
